Situation Awareness: Bullish. The market is driven by a “peace trade” narrative as U.S.-Iran negotiations show significant progress, sending oil lower and yields down. Index futures are trading well above fair value, with the S&P 500 attempting its ninth consecutive weekly gain. Trade mode: Aggressive breakout on macro catalysts. The tape is responding to geopolitical de-escalation, with the 10-year Treasury yield dropping 8 bps to 4.48% and WTI crude falling 4.1% to $92.65. Regime context — 57.82% of stocks trade above their 40-day SMA, a marginal increase from Friday’s 57.79%, while the 4% Bull/Bear gauge shows 219 bulls vs. 50 bears. The 5-day trend shows a consistent up sequence, with the S&P 500 extending its winning streak to eight weeks.
